CONSENT AGENDA
--
Separations:
A.
Bid Awards:
1.
2011 Aerial Truck for Street/Traffic Division. (Opened 3/22/11) (Delayed from 3/28/11) Recommend Motor Power; $114,722.
2.
W.O. 10-17, Billings Waste Water Treatment Plant - Natural Gas Line Replacement. (Opened 3/29/11) Recommend Montana Dakota Utilities; $102,932.
3.
W.O. 11-04, 2011 ADA Accessibility Ramps. (Opened 3/29/11) Recommend CMG Construction; $317,407.
4.
Taxiway G Relocation and Runway Overlay Project. (Opened 3/29/11) Recommend postponement of bid award until April 25, 2011.
5.
Structural Repairs to Park II Parking Garage. (Opened 4/5/2011) Recommend delay of award until April 25, 2011.
B.
Approval of new Commercial Terminal Building Lease with Frontier Airlines, Inc.; 3/1/2011 - 2/29/2012 with automatic annual renewals; Revenue first year - $7,482.72.
C.
Approval of 10-year lease renewal with State of Montana DNRC for Airport Buffer Zone. (3/1/2011-2/28/2021); annual rent first five years - $20,000.
D.
Approval of new lease agreement with Tami Kelling dba Downtown Subs to include additional storage space (3-year lease with two, one-year renewal options). Revenue first year - $13,692; Revenue second and third years - $13,855.
E.
Acceptance of YMCA proposal to pay off combined principal balance on two delinquent Revolving Fund loans totaling $269,109; and write-off accrued interest totaling $138,941.
F.
Revolving Fund Loan to Billings Depot, Inc. to purchase lease of parking lot on Montana Avenue west of Depot property from Computers Unlimited; not to exceed $45,500.
G.
Street Closures:
1.
Cinco de Mayo Celebration. May 7, 2011; 10 a.m. to 8:00 p.m.; North 26th Street between Montana Avenue and 1st Avenue North.
H.
Approval and acceptance of 2011 ConocoPhillips Company grant; $6,000 to the Police Department; $6,000 to the Fire Department.
I.
Acceptance of Sponsorships for Infill Policy Workshop, April 26 & 27, 2011. Billings Home Builders Association - $1,500; Billings Association of Realtors - $2,500; Sanderson Stewart - $800; Cole Law Firm - $500; Montana Association of Planners - $500; Healthy By Design - $1,000.
